Unpublished Research (Degree Thesis)

Master Degree Thesis: University of Birmingham, Sept. 1975 “An empirical study investigating the technical and mechanical aspects of the free throw”. This empirical study assessed the mechanical aspects of acquiring and performing specific motor skill. Also, it investigated the importance of the skill through the analysis of 105 matches played at National and European championships level.

PhD Thesis: University of Birmingham, Sept. 1978 “An investigation into some aspects of the social facilitation phenomenon in sport with special reference to the effects of expert audience on performance.” This psych-physiological study used psychometric and physiological tests to explore the effect of audience on performance of motor tasks with different levels of complexity.
